Compliance with minimum social standards and occupational safety standards
The ILO labour standards at the production site are complied with.
Four basic principles underpin the ethos and actions of the International Labour Organisation (ILO):
- Freedom of association and the right to collective bargaining
- Elimination of forced labour
- Abolition of child labour
- Elimination of discrimination in respect of employment and occupation
Eight common features (core labour standards) can be derived from these basic principles. For natureplus certification, all ILO stipulated requirements must be met without exception.
